But what if your existing petrol car is still working fine – or is even only a year or two old? Contrary to popular belief, the overall climate impact is lower if a new petrol car is scrapped in favour of an electric vehicle (EV), new research reveals. Studies show that although EVs produce more carbon emissions when they are manufactured, they are responsible for much lower emissions when they are being driven compared with a petrol or diesel car. Overall, the whole-life emissions for an electric car are almost 90 per cent lower than for combustion engine vehicles. Using US data, they analysed the emissions impact of scrapping a fossil fuel car and replacing it with an EV at different points, from scrapping a car that is just a year or two old to one at the end of its life. Their modelling accounts for the emissions associated with producing and running a new electric car, and other factors including variability in the grid electricity mix, vehicle efficiency, manufacturing emissions and mileage. “We found that in the vast majority of cases, and even for a brand new gas vehicle, you would be far better off scrapping the gas vehicle and switching to electric,” says Campbell. “It takes more energy to build an electric vehicle, but the savings from driving the vehicle swamp all the upfront costs.” Campbell stresses he doesn’t expect people to immediately scrap their brand new cars. Instead, the study aims to show that there is zero environmental benefit in keeping a fossil fuel car on the road until the end of its life. The findings hold true for almost any scenario, except where an electricity grid is very reliant on coal power, or when a fossil fuel car is driven less than about 7000 km per year. “The idea here is just to simply show what a huge advantage electric vehicles offer, so that when the opportunity to make the transition [is] something that people are ready and excited to do, by all means go for it,” says Campbell. “There’s no environmental concern to hold you back.” Kenneth Gillingham at the Yale University says the paper takes a “clever angle”. “I think what they’re talking about makes perfect sense. Instead, those cars will likely hit the second-hand market, which could have knock-on economic and behavioural impacts, such as lowering the price of second-hand cars so dramatically that it convinces more people to switch from public transport to car use. More research is needed to model those potential impacts, says Campbell. But the study’s authors say their findings lend support to the idea of subsidised scrappage schemes, to encourage people to scrap older fossil-fuel cars in favour of electric vehicles. Such policies could accelerate the EV transition in the US and help to cut transportation emissions, which are now the single largest source of carbon emissions in the country. JohnMo Posted 1 hour ago Posted 1 hour ago More nonsense. The petrol car is made how does scrapping it make any sense. Typical CO2 emissions for a petrol car are 230g per mile, so 7000km is 1000 kg. It takes 5 to 10 tonnes to produce an electric car, so already the electric car needs to exist 5 to 10 years to get pay back compared to an existing petrol car. But that doesn't include grid CO2 to charge vehicle etc.which would extend CO2 payback also Typical car average life before being scrapped is 17 years, except Ford's and Vauxhall which is sooner. So may make sense to scrap petrols at between around 10 years, but not a new car or 2 year old one. But scrap all diesels cars tomorrow would be my view. The CO2 cost for burning fuel in an ICE car also needs to take into account the CO2 cost of extracting, manufacturing, and shipping the fuel to petrol station, the emmissions cost of spillages, emmissions during filling up the car, etc. Add to that the low efficiency of the engine in using the fuel (60% is wasted heat and friction) and the fun fact that you can only burn it once. Think well-to-wheel, not vehicle mpg and you will start to see the logic of studies like this. Even when burning FF, electricity generation efficiency and minimal transmission losses make it far more efficient. The most profligate EV (Ferrari, Maserati, ancient Enfield Electric) will still use the 'fuel' with +80% efficiency of conversion. And, unlike ICE, you get some of the expended energy back when you brake or go downhill. Add in that the valuable minerals in car batteries and drive systems will be recycled (+99.6% recyclability of materials, plus reusing Lithium from existing batteries saves more energy as it is already purified). I heard an expert from a mining company say that within 20 years, most battery and magnet materials used in vehicles in the future will come from the circular economy rather than mining extraction.
